Output efcea2cbae9d15ea6490ce74438d3ed8d6910018a24336976393a9562103f8ce:1

value
7211887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d71cd71fea36e6b8f3618186bee7f9598cf4ebe OP_EQUAL
address
37HuUPBE9VPKjDRzmLqEiU4SjK1ubWuDon
transaction
efcea2cbae9d15ea6490ce74438d3ed8d6910018a24336976393a9562103f8ce
spent
true